> Hmm, interesting. Can you try disabling some of the probes for
> extended keyboards in atkbd.c to see if some of them could confuse
> your keyboard so that the BIOS doesn't like it after boot? Also you
> may want to kill the keyboard reset on reboot ... (atkbd_cleanup) ...

I've been following this because my Dell Latitude C810 has the
"keyboard/mouse doesn't work after reboot" with all of the recent 2.5.x
kernel that I have tried.

When I saw the suggestion above to try removing the keyboard reset I
thought that was just too easy to pass up giving it a try. Sure enough,
removing just the one line that preforms the keyboard reset from
atkbd_cleanup solves the problem for me. Now I guess it's time to try
to determine why, and what the real fix should likely be.

Just thought it might be valuable to have another report about the
problem.
